Output e594b62324efb0ea679ec1fdace540364d06adca75c440bd7b8a2736fd3315e5:0

value
949
script pubkey
OP_0 OP_PUSHBYTES_20 16f5b0dfca2e5ab7b8c0cf7bbbd538480e7806bb
address
bc1qzm6mph729edt0wxqeaamh4fcfq88sp4meetklc
transaction
e594b62324efb0ea679ec1fdace540364d06adca75c440bd7b8a2736fd3315e5
confirmations
3727
spent
true